Just Arrived: A new Simon Ambridge (England) Hauser I Copy. About his Hauser I copies Simon Ambridge writes: "In 2008 I had the opportunity to measure and absorb a fine 1940 Hauser I guitar, a copy of which I am now offering in my range of instruments. For me the original represents a kind of perfection of the luthier's craft in terms of its restrained aesthetic and refinement of tone. In November 2009 Julian Bream purchased a Hauser I copy from me, a guitar which he is delighted with not only for its overall appearance but in terms of its weight, feel and sound qualities...."

Just Arrived: Sheldon Urlik's magnificent new A Collection of Fine Spanish Guitars from Torres to the Present, 2nd Edition.This wonderful book is a comparative study of 80-plus Classical and Flamenco guitars in, likely, the finest collection of Spanish guitars existent. Each guitar has a chapter containing a detailed physical description, comments, insights, anecdotes, notes on its maker and an array of photographs. New 2nd Edition Features include: Three beautifully recorded audio CDs for listening to the collection, all new highest quality digital photography and color accuracy, over 50 more pages than the 1st edition...

Just Arrived: Three new Visesnot ultra light flight cases with carbon black, copper bronze, and black exteriors. The Visesnut case weighs only seven pounds. Its body is made from a unique double wall structure designed to absorb impacts and insulate from extreme temperature changes. The case's interior is lined with a soft plush material and a unique adjustable cushioned suspension system which allows the case's side padding to be adjusted via a support belt to fit the outline of just about any standard and many smaller size classical guitars...

Just Arrived: A new 2015 Gregory Byers concert guitar with an all wood double fan lattice bracing system and laminated sides for additional power and projection. This guitar also features an elevated fingerboard with a 20th first string fret, Rodgers L201 tuning machine heads with ebony oval buttons, a perfectly executed 'V' graft head to neck joint, immaculate workmanship, French polish of shellac finish, Byers' proprietary nut and saddle compensation system for unusually accurate intonation, and superb materials and workmanship...
